I have just finished installing the -current branch of Slackware64 in my PC. It was not an update, I formatted the disk and did a clean install.
I wanted to create my users and I realised that now you need to set an non-empty password for yours users.
I used to have my login with an empty password (just push enter when I was asked for my password) and I would like to keep it in that way. I suppose it is related with the change to PAM. Is there any way to change the configuration and allows empty passwords for users?
